Escape to the serene and lesser-known jewel of Rwanda’s conservation landscape—Gishwati-Mukura National Park. This newly established park, part of Rwanda’s protected Albertine Rift region, offers a raw and intimate forest experience. It’s ideal for eco-tourists, primate lovers, and travelers looking to explore Rwanda beyond the crowds.
Gishwati is a compact yet biologically rich montane rainforest, home to wild chimpanzees, golden monkeys, L’Hoest’s monkeys, and an array of birdlife. As part of a broader reforestation and community-based conservation effort, the park showcases Rwanda’s commitment to protecting biodiversity while empowering local communities. Chimpanzee & Monkey Tracking: Walk through the misty forest trails in search of wild chimpanzees and playful monkey species.
Guided Forest Hike: Explore the regenerating rainforest with expert rangers who explain its flora, fauna, and conservation efforts.
Birdwatching: Spot some of the 230+ bird species, including Albertine Rift endemics like the Ruwenzori turaco and mountain masked apalis.
Community Experience: Visit local cooperatives and learn how reforestation is benefiting both wildlife and people.
Scenic Drive through Rwanda’s Western Corridor: Travel through hills, tea plantations, and rural landscapes.
